Background

Owning a dog has been associated with improved well-being and this study focused on dog ownership in children with neurodevelopmental disorders (NDD), especially in autism spectrum disorder (ASD).

Methods

This systematic review utilised Preferred Reporting Items for Systematic Review and Meta-Analysis Protocols (PRISMA-P) and three databases, EMBASE, MEDLINE and Cochrane Library, to assess dog ownership and neurodevelopmental outcomes. Paper screening and data extraction were performed in duplicate using Covidence. The five domains of neurodevelopment that were reviewed included cognitive, social and emotional, speech and language, fine motor and gross motor developmental outcomes.

Results

There were 451 papers reviewed and 16 were included in the final analysis. Despite heterogeneous reporting methods, the impact of dog ownership on children with ASD was positive across multiple domains of neurodevelopment. Fourteen studies reported improved emotional regulation and social engagement in children with ASD with a dog. Improvements in cognitive, speech and language function were reported in seven studies. Additionally, in six of the studies, a pet dog improved family dynamics and reduced anxiety levels in parents of children with ASD. The most common study design included in the systematic review was cross-sectional studies, labrador-retrievers were the most commonly reported dog breed. Eight studies reported the presence of an additional household pet.

Conclusion

Dog ownership was a feasible non-pharmacological intervention, as part of a global, multi-disciplinary approach for children with NDD. Large prospective cohort studies could investigate the mechanism by which dogs provide positive changes in the life of a child with ASD and long-term outcomes.

Impact

This study highlights that dog ownership in children with neurodevelopment disorders is associated with longstanding benefits in neurodevelopmental outcomes and has wider-reaching effects on the child’s family.

This is the first systematic review examining the effect of dog ownership in this cohort and hopes to progress the field of dog ownership in paediatric neurodevelopmental disorders.

The lasting impact dogs have on the lives of children with neurodevelopmental disorders should be viewed as a non-pharmacological adjunct to the holistic care of this patient cohort and highlights the potential for implementation of animal-assisted interventions in future treatment plans.
